Here is what the Mystics are doing in the 2024-25 WNBA offseason
Briefly

The 2024-25 WNBA offseason finds players exploring diverse paths, from resting to competing in winter leagues domestically and various international competitions.
Brittney Sykes is excited to join Unrivaled, a new winter women's basketball league, showing the growing opportunities for women's basketball in the USA.
Ariel Atkins' move to Fenerbahçe promises excitement as she partners with Emma Meesseman, a potential EuroLeague MVP, showcasing the high stakes of European basketball.
Many Mystics players are heading to Turkey, where the competitive basketball scene offers immense growth opportunities, including participation in the prestigious EuroLeague.
